Endress+Hauser Proline Cubemass C 300 Coriolis Flowmeter
The Endress+Hauser Proline Cubemass C 300 is a compact Coriolis flowmeter designed for accurate measurement of the smallest quantities of liquids and gases. It combines a space-saving single-tube sensor with a compact, easily accessible transmitter, making it well suited for skids, test rigs, industrial robotics and other space-constrained process systems.
Cubemass C 300 uses the Coriolis measuring principle to directly measure mass flow while also providing density, temperature and volume flow information. The measurement principle operates independently of physical fluid properties such as viscosity and density, helping provide stable measurement performance under changing process conditions.
Precise Measurement of Very Small Flow Rates
The Cubemass C series is specifically designed for smallest flow quantities. Cubemass C 300 is available in nominal diameters from DN1 to DN6 (1/24 to 1/4"), with a measuring range of up to 1,000 kg/h (37 lb/min).
This makes it suitable for applications where accurate low-flow measurement is required without using a large flowmeter.

High-Accuracy Coriolis Measurement
The Promass/Cubemass Coriolis technology provides accurate measurement of both liquids and gases. For Cubemass C 300, the maximum measurement errors are:
Liquid mass flow: ±0.10%
Liquid volume flow: ±0.10%
Gas mass flow: ±0.50%
Liquid density: ±0.0005 g/cm³
The instrument can measure multiple process variables from a single measuring point, including mass flow, volume flow, corrected volume flow, density, reference density, temperature and concentration.
Compact Single-Tube Sensor
The Cubemass C 300 features a space-saving single-tube sensor with a lightweight construction. This design helps simplify installation in compact equipment and skid systems where available space is limited.
The wetted measuring tube is manufactured from 1.4539 (904L) stainless steel, while the process connections are available in 1.4539 (904L) and 1.4404 (316/316L) depending on configuration.
The compact sensor design also supports applications where measurement accuracy must be maintained under high pressure and alternating flow conditions.
High-Pressure Process Measurement
Despite its compact size, Cubemass C 300 supports demanding process conditions.
The maximum process pressure reaches 400 bar (5800 psi), while the medium temperature range is -50 to +205 °C (-58 to +401 °F).
This combination of small-flow measurement, high pressure and wide temperature capability makes Cubemass C 300 suitable for specialized industrial process applications.
Compact and Easily Accessible Transmitter
One of the defining features of Cubemass C 300 is its compact, easily accessible transmitter.
The transmitter uses a dual-compartment housing and provides access to process and diagnostic information through flexible I/O and fieldbus configurations. It supports up to three I/Os, while the backlit display provides touch control and WLAN access. A remote display is also available.
The transmitter can be accessed from one side, which can simplify operation and maintenance in installations with limited access space.

Heartbeat Technology
The Cubemass C 300 incorporates Endress+Hauser Heartbeat Technology for integrated measurement verification and diagnostics.
Heartbeat Technology helps users verify measurement performance and support compliant verification without removing the flowmeter from the process. This can contribute to improved measurement reliability, preventive maintenance and process availability.
